What Is Membership Programs For Creator Income?
Membership programs are a way for creators to earn money by offering special content or perks to their fans. Think of it like a club where people pay to join and get access to unique experiences, behind-the-scenes looks, or exclusive materials.
These programs can be a great way for creators to build a community and connect with their audience on a deeper level. Members often feel more involved and appreciated, which can lead to loyal support. It’s a simple idea: people pay for special access and creators get a chance to earn a steady income while sharing what they love.
Why Membership Programs For Creator Income Is Important
Membership programs are a great way for creators to earn steady income. They allow fans to support their favorite creators directly. This means creators can focus more on their work without worrying as much about where the next paycheck will come from.
These programs help build a strong community. When fans join, they feel more connected and involved. This connection can lead to more engagement and loyalty, which benefits both creators and their supporters.

Common Mistakes and Myths
Many people think that starting a membership program is super easy and will make money overnight. The truth is, it takes time and effort to build a community that supports you. You can’t just set it and forget it. You need to engage with your members and keep the content fresh and exciting.
Another common myth is that you need a huge following to start a membership program. While having a big audience helps, it’s more about the connection you have with your members. Focus on quality over quantity. Even a small group of loyal supporters can bring you great success!

Beginner Tips
Starting a membership program can feel overwhelming, but it doesn’t have to be. Focus on what you love and share that passion with your audience. Remember, being genuine goes a long way in building trust.
Engage with your members regularly. Ask for their feedback and make them feel included. It’s all about creating a community where everyone feels welcome and valued. Keep things simple, and don’t be afraid to show your personality!
Advanced Tips
When creating a membership program, focus on building a community. People join not just for content, but to connect with others. Engage with your members regularly through Q&A sessions or feedback polls. This makes them feel valued and more likely to stick around.
Another key point is to offer exclusive content that genuinely interests your audience. Think about what they want to learn or experience. This could be behind-the-scenes looks, special tutorials, or personal stories. Keep it fresh and fun to maintain their interest!
